Fullstack Developer (Angular, Java)
Location: Hybrid/Wrocław (3 days per week in the office)
Full-time
Contract B2B
We are currently seeking an experienced Fullstack Developer (Angular, Java) on behalf of our client. The Software Developer will work within a Development team and may be involved in the development of new products and maintenance of existing products including the design, installation, testing and maintenance of software systems.
- Design, develop, test, and maintain full-stack applications using Java/Spring Boot on the backend and Angular on the frontend
- Build scalable APIs, microservices, and UI components for enterprise-grade platforms
- Ensure application performance, code quality, security, and reliability through best engineering practices
- Participate in code reviews, design discussions, and continuous improvement initiatives
- Troubleshoot production issues, perform root cause analysis, and implement sustainable fixes
- Contribute to CI/CD pipelines, automated testing, and DevOps practices to improve software delivery
- Support integration with databases, messaging systems, and third-party/internal enterprise services
- Follow Agile/Scrum practices and actively participate in sprint ceremonies
Required Qualifications:
- Minimum 4 years of experience in a similar position
- Strong hands-on experience in Java ( 17/21+) development, with Spring Boot and microservices architecture
- Solid experience in Angular ( 14/16+), TypeScript, HTML, CSS, and responsive UI development
- Good understanding of REST APIs, backend integration patterns, and secure application design
- Experience with relational databases such as Oracle, SQL Server, or PostgreSQL
- Familiarity with source control tools such as Git, and CI/CD tools such as Jenkins, GitHub Actions, or similar
- Understanding software development lifecycle, testing frameworks, and Agile methodologies
- Strong analytical, problem-solving, and communication skills
- Fluency in English both written and verbal (minimum B2 level)
What We Offer:
-
Collaboration in an international environment
-
Opportunity to work on large-scale, cloud-based, modern projects
-
Full support and knowledge-sharing within an experienced team
-
Opportunities to grow your technical skills and work on innovative initiatives
-
Competitive B2B contract remuneration